Dental implants for individuals with gum disease current unique challenges and concerns. While implants have established themselves as a reliable resolution for tooth loss, the presence of gum disease can complicate the state of affairs. Understanding these complexities may help individuals make informed decisions relating to their oral health.
Gum disease, specifically periodontitis, is a bacterial infection that impacts the gums and can result in important bone loss around the teeth. This condition poses a risk for anybody considering dental implants. Before embarking on implant surgery, it's essential to handle the gum disease successfully. Managing gum health not only facilitates successful implant placement but in addition ensures the long-term viability of the implant.

Successful dental implant insertion relies closely on a wholesome foundation of bone and gum tissue. In patients with lively gum disease, bone density and tissue quality may be compromised. This raises issues about the ability of dental implants to combine with the encircling structures. For this reason, complete remedy plans typically embody periodontal therapy before any consideration of implants.
Patients might have to undergo scaling and root planing, procedures designed to take away tartar and bacteria from beneath the gum line. This helps in reversing or managing early levels of gum disease, permitting the gums to heal and regain strength. Often, patients are instructed to hold up rigorous oral hygiene routines, including common professional cleanings and at-home care, to boost recovery.
For people who've skilled vital bone loss as a result of gum disease, bone grafting could also be needed previous to implant placement. This process includes transplanting bone tissue to the world where the implant might be placed to provide the required support. The incorporation of grafted materials may be important in achieving a successful consequence for dental implants.

The timing of therapy is another crucial issue. For some, periodontal health may stabilize post-treatment whereas others could require more steady management. In some instances, it may be prudent to place the dental implant solely after reaching a healthy oral setting. Close monitoring by dental professionals permits for tailored approaches to every particular person's situation.
Once gum disease is managed, the implant course of can begin. This typically includes inserting a titanium publish into the jawbone, where it's going to serve as a root for the artificial tooth. The healing interval that follows is called osseointegration, a phase where the bone fuses to the implant. Patients with a history of gum disease ought to remain vigilant throughout this phase, as problems can come up if correct care is not maintained.

After the implant has totally integrated, the ultimate restoration could be positioned. This normally involves a crown designed to blend seamlessly with current natural teeth. Aesthetics and functionality are key issues throughout this stage, guaranteeing not only a satisfying appearance but also a secure chunk.
Ongoing maintenance is particularly necessary for individuals with a history of gum disease. Routine check-ups, customized oral hygiene regimens, and life-style adjustments can make a substantial distinction in implant longevity. Keeping the gums wholesome is crucial to forestall issues that might jeopardize the integrity of the implant.

What are dental implants?
Dental implants are synthetic tooth roots positioned into the jawbone to help replacement teeth or bridges, offering a robust foundation for fastened or removable teeth.

Can individuals with gum disease get dental implants?
While gum disease can complicate the process, it’s attainable for people with a history of gum disease to obtain implants after appropriate treatment and stabilization of their gum health.
What is the process for getting dental implants if I even have gum disease?
The course of usually involves first treating the gum disease, ensuring gum tissue is healthy, followed by implant placement, and then permitting adequate healing time before putting the ultimate restoration.

How is gum disease handled before dental implant placement?
The treatment normally entails professional cleansing, scaling and root planing, and sometimes surgery to take away infected tissue and promote gum therapeutic.
